The Australian Department of Climate Change has recently held briefing sessions on its National Carbon Offset Standard discussion paper. A copy of the slides presented is available here. Submissions are due on the paper by Friday 27 February.

A major point of discussion at the 4th Australia-New Zealand Climate Change & Business Conference in Auckland was the question of how a voluntary market might operate within a compliance environment. To provide clarification for delegates on the issue and the various perspectives referenced at the Conference, the Climate Change & Business Centre has prepared a summary overview, Voluntary Market Credits: Credibility in a Compliance Market
